The ongoing conflict between Ukraine and Russia has prompted the United States to send military aid to the region, including weapons and ammunition. But with the US facing increasing demand for weapons from various countries worldwide, could there be a shortage of firearms for domestic use due to this aid? 

Ultimately, it remains to be seen whether or not the US will face a weapon shortage as it continues to aid Ukraine. However, this question raises important considerations about the costs and benefits of providing military aid to other countries and the impact such assistance could have on domestic resources.
